Broadfoot agrees Ibrox stay
21 Jun 2010 - 19:01:36
Scotland defender Kirk Broadfoot has committed his long-term future to Rangers by signing a new three-year contract with the SPL champions.
The 25-year-old had been linked with a summer move to England, but has now extended his Ibrox stay, having joined the Gers in the summer of 2007 from St Mirren.
He told the club's official website: "I'm delighted to stay. To play with a club like Rangers for another three years is great as they're the team I supported as a boy.
"Everyone knows that and it's great to be part of the squad for the forthcoming season, when we'll look to retain our SPL title.
"I said from day one that I wanted to stay here if we could do a deal and while I did go and meet other people, my heart was always here.
"I won't lie. I thought there was a point when I was going to leave, but it was so hard to get my head around moving on."
